Welcome Back Apple Picking

Apple Picking was a blast and a great way to start off our 2024-2025 Program Year! Garret loved the tire playground and racing down on the slides. Morgan and Kofi found some of the prettiest apples in the Orchard, and Trio enjoyed the hayride. We had a wonderful lunch in the pavilion and brought in the new year with tons of yummy treats including honey sticks and apple sauce. Thank you to our Parent Volunteers and everyone who made the event so fun!
